Grahams Natural Baby Eczema Cream is a 75g clinically proven, steroid-free, and fragrance-free moisturizing lotion designed for infants and children up to 12 years. Enriched with natural ingredients like Colloidal Oatmeal and Shea Butter, it gently relieves eczema symptoms including dryness, redness, and itchiness while supporting the skin’s microbiome. Registered as a Class I Medical Device, it offers safe, effective, and daily eczema relief without harsh chemicals.

Great for irritated baby skin
Both my nephew and I struggle with dry flaky skin, but we're always worried about how his skin might react to new products, so I tried it first. I found it went on well, with minimal greasiness and is quite light. While it's not a miracle ointment, it has worked very well on both of us, and while I still use some of the stronger stuff, it has become the go-to cream for my nephew, as it seems to settle his skin down very well. Very pleased with this

A lovely cream that makes dry skin feel nice and smooth 👶
Grahams Natural Baby Eczema Cream is a mild cream based on natural ingredients, particularly suitable for soothing, caring and providing relief.My granddaughter who's aged 2.8 has sensitive skin and gets eczema flare ups, and this cream helps to calm it down.I've been using it on my granddaughter for about 2 weeks now and it has been wonderful in keeping the eczema subdued.After trying every ointment, cream, and moisturiser out there, it's one of the best eczema cream I've tried. It soothes and moisturises her sensitive and dry skin and is also great for the hands and face during these cold spells of our autumn and winter seasons.Made with naturally soothing ingredients like oatmeal, olive oil, jojoba oil, shea butter and cocoa butter, it is an effective treatment to relieve itchiness, inflammation, redness, and dryness.It's key ingredients:Olea Europaea Fruit Oil and Tocopheryl Acetate (antioxidants)Avena Sativa, Allantoin, Bisabolol (soothing)Contains no steroids, parabens, artificial/synthetic fragrances, petroleum, SLS or sulfates, silicones, PEGs, phthalates, harsh preservatives, gluten and no animal testing.Hydrating and calming. It doesn't leave a greasy film and absorbs fast.For best results, use in conjunction with Grahams Natural Baby Eczema Body & Bath Oil.There's no uncertainty that this is a fabulous product but it's rather expensive for just a travel size.
